X1L3 - AY 300 + YM 300 + GT 300 - comparison - eurorack modules
video upload by X1L3
"Side by side comparison of the three flavours of the '300' chip tune module.
👾👾👾👾👾👾👾👾
Busy chip tune composition to hit them hard with lots of micro note hopping, and the modulator running 1voct on channel 1 to generate the 'SIDvoice' on the bass line, and to create the drum/percussive sounds when hit with fast CV spikes instead of using the noise channel. Demoscene tricks that i wanted to include in the modules from the start through a sense of completeness in having them behave as close as possible to if they were tied to a CPU.
There's very little difference between the three. The YM is a superior chip and addresses the low level audio channel cross talk that the AY and it's direct clones exhibit. It makes little difference to the sound in a loaded 3 channel composition like this though. The YM is maybe ever so slightly cleaner than the AY and WF.
If you're a masochist like me then you basically get to relive turning your telly up full blast in the 80s to hear the same strident bit of chip tune three times, while pissing your parents off and being told to turn it down, for no other reason than becasue you can 🤣🤣
AY 300 - General instruments - AY-3-8910
YM 300 - Yamaha - YM2149F
GT 300 - Winbond - WF19054
The AY3 was released in 1978 and used in tons of home computers like the ZX Spectrum, Vectrex and Amstrad CPC.
The YM2149 some time in the mid 80s i believe. I remember it well from the Atari ST. And how disappointed i was with the sound of the ST compared to the SID chip in Commodore 64.
The Winbond AY clone is as far as i know still made today for use in slot and pinball machines."

Frank Pels - 40 Musical & Usable Sounds for Blofeld Plugin - Sounddemo
video upload by WaldorfMusicChannel
"The soundset is available in the Waldorf Shop
https://waldorfmusic.com/produkt/soun...
The Blofeld soundset contains 40 typical wavetable sounds, solo leads, pads & drones as well as a lot of presets that you can always use. All sounds are very musical and can be used immediately in any style of music. The soundset is using the powerful sound engine of the new Blofeld Plugin to its fullest and can be imported via the plugin.
Frank Pels is a musician & producer from the Netherlands who has been involved with wavetable synthesis from the beginning. He has owned many legendary synthesizers like Prophet VS, Waldorf Microwave 1 & 2 over the years. He was immediately fascinated by the Waldorf Blofeld Plugin and now delivers a soundset for this software instrument."
ULT-SOUND DS-1 different kinds of noise demonstration
video upload by Korablove Roman
"DS-1 is a eurorack version of ULT_SOUND DS-4M. DS-1 includes the features of all DS-4 versions. In addition the following features have been added: MIX between VCO and NOISE sources, TRIANGLE in vco part, EXTERNAL INPUT in NOISE sources (all 4 percussion kinds of noise are also there), LFO SPEED and LEVEL controls, LFO RETRIGGER, SWEEP level control. Will be available in two versions: classic black/white and “custom” yellow/blue. Shipping will start in January 2025. Manual and more info will come soon..."
